What is Cholera and Why It Needs Attention?
Cholera is an acute diarrheal illness caused by infection with the Vibrio cholerae bacteria. It's primarily spread through contaminated food and water. Ignoring Cholera can lead to severe dehydration, kidney failure, and even death within hours, making prompt attention absolutely necessary.
Common Causes of Cholera
The most frequent primary cause of Cholera: Is drinking water or eating food contaminated with the Cholera bacterium.
The most common secondary cause of Cholera: Is inadequate sanitation and hygiene practices, allowing the bacteria to spread easily within communities.
An important lifestyle or environmental trigger for Cholera: Is the consumption of raw or undercooked seafood from contaminated waters, a potential risk factor especially if sourced from unregulated vendors.
Symptoms of Cholera That Need Medical Attention
The most concerning symptom of Cholera: Is profuse, watery diarrhoea, often described as "rice-water stool," leading to rapid dehydration.
A symptom indicating the condition is worsening: Is muscle cramps, which result from severe electrolyte imbalances due to fluid loss.
A symptom that requires immediate medical help: Is a decreased level of consciousness or signs of shock, indicating a critical state of dehydration and organ dysfunction.
Diagnosing Cholera and When to Seek Medical Help
When you consult a Cholera doctor near me in Virender Nagar, they will first take a detailed medical history, focusing on your symptoms, travel history, and potential exposure to contaminated food or water. A physical examination will assess your level of dehydration. To confirm the diagnosis, a stool sample will be collected and sent to a laboratory for testing to identify the Vibrio cholerae bacteria. You should seek immediate medical help if you experience sudden onset of profuse diarrhoea, especially if accompanied by vomiting, signs of dehydration (such as decreased urination, dizziness, or sunken eyes), or if you suspect exposure to contaminated sources. Cholera Treatments and Remedies
Medical treatments: The primary medical intervention for Cholera is rapid rehydration therapy, typically administered intravenously to replace lost fluids and electrolytes. Oral rehydration solutions (ORS) are also crucial for milder cases and maintaining hydration after initial intravenous treatment. Antibiotics, such as doxycycline or azithromycin, may be prescribed to shorten the duration of the illness and reduce the shedding of bacteria. Zinc supplementation can also reduce the duration and severity of diarrhoea, especially in children.
Home remedies: While medical treatment is essential, supportive home care includes consuming clear fluids like boiled and cooled water, diluted fruit juices, and homemade ORS. Avoid sugary drinks, as they can worsen diarrhoea. Light, easily digestible foods, such as khichdi or plain rice, can be gradually reintroduced as tolerated.
Lifestyle changes: The best way to prevent Cholera is through improved sanitation and hygiene. Always wash your hands thoroughly with soap and water, especially before eating and after using the toilet. Consume food from trusted sources, and ensure it is properly cooked. Drink only boiled or bottled water. Avoid ice from unknown sources. Proper disposal of sewage and waste is crucial to prevent water contamination in the community.
